First publication! Precision torture test for BOTH printer AND slicers. Print with slowest speed and 50% infill AND AGAIN at 5/10% infill X carriage features 10mm cubes stepping down 5mm Y axis features 0.5mm stepdowns upwards Downward Y is 0.2mm stepdown and a 0.5mm inset. WHAT TO LOOK FOR: MASSIVELY IMPORTANT that if you're on ABS you allow your model to COOL before measurement Trim model CAREFULLY, undercut if you need to in order to preserve the face Look for edges being "square" and not rounded off, scalloped or distorted. Differences between 5/10% and 50% infill will give insight as to how the material cools and "contracts" Always observe perpendicular to the surface being measured with your calipers - observe dips or sags.
